Liam Crilly 9ff59e6c4b Tools: improved ps(1) portability for unitc.
Improved cross-platform support by trying multiple ps(1) invocations to
obtain the unitd command line parameters. Additional error checking
detects when this process fails.

The first attempt uses `ps -wwo args=COMMAND -p` which has very broad
support and has the additional benefit of simplifying the output for
more reliable parsing of the process info. If that fails then we fall
back to simply `ps`.

The parsing of the process info has also changed. Instead of converting
'[]' into spaces we now convert them into explicit delimiters (using '^').
This is more reliable as it marks the beginning and the end of the info
we care about. Any trailing process information is now ignored (FreeBSD).

Additional error handling improves the robustness when starting unitd with
a different filename or from a relative path. In this case the control
socket and log file detection will fail when running `unitd --help`.
Additional error checking and messages are displayed when the control socket
cannot be determined. A single warning is shown when the log file cannot be
determined.

NGINX Unit

Universal Web App Server

NGINX Unit Logo

NGINX Unit is a lightweight and versatile open-source server that has two primary capabilities:

  • serves static media assets,
  • runs application code in seven languages.

Unit compresses several layers of the modern application stack into a potent, coherent solution with a focus on performance, low latency, and scalability. It is intended as a universal building block for any web architecture regardless of its complexity, from enterprise-scale deployments to your pet's homepage.

Its native RESTful JSON API enables dynamic updates with zero interruptions and flexible configuration, while its out-of-the-box productivity reliably scales to production-grade workloads. We achieve that with a complex, asynchronous, multithreading architecture comprising multiple processes to ensure security and robustness while getting the most out of today's computing platforms.

Running a Hello World App

Suppose you saved a PHP script as /www/helloworld/index.php:

<?php echo "Hello, PHP on Unit!"; ?>

To run it on Unit with the unit-php module installed, first set up an application object. Let's store our first config snippet in a file called config.json:

{
    "helloworld": {
        "type": "php",
        "root": "/www/helloworld/"
    }
}

Saving it as a file isn't necessary, but can come in handy with larger objects.

Now, PUT it into the /config/applications section of Unit's control API, usually available by default via a Unix domain socket:

# curl -X PUT --data-binary @config.json --unix-socket  \
       /path/to/control.unit.sock http://localhost/config/applications

{
	"success": "Reconfiguration done."
}

Next, reference the app from a listener object in the /config/listeners section of the API. This time, we pass the config snippet straight from the command line:

# curl -X PUT -d '{"127.0.0.1:8000": {"pass": "applications/helloworld"}}'  \
       --unix-socket /path/to/control.unit.sock http://localhost/config/listeners
{
    "success": "Reconfiguration done."
}

Now Unit accepts requests at the specified IP and port, passing them to the application process. Your app works!

$ curl 127.0.0.1:8080

      Hello, PHP on Unit!

Finally, query the entire /config section of the control API:

# curl --unix-socket /path/to/control.unit.sock http://localhost/config/

Unit's output should contain both snippets, neatly organized:

{
    "listeners": {
        "127.0.0.1:8080": {
            "pass": "applications/helloworld"
        }
    },

    "applications": {
        "helloworld": {
            "type": "php",
            "root": "/www/helloworld/"
        }
    }
}

For full details of configuration management, see the docs.

OpenAPI Specification

Our OpenAPI specification aims to simplify configuring and integrating NGINX Unit deployments and provide an authoritative source of knowledge about the control API.

Although the specification is still in the early beta stage, it is a promising step forward for the NGINX Unit community. While working on it, we kindly ask you to experiment and provide feedback to help improve its functionality and usability.
